在 Mac、工厂 EFI 或其他启动器上进行双重启动

在 Mac、工厂 EFI 或其他启动器上进行双重启动

如果我想在 MacBook Pro 上实现双重启动,我是否应该使用 Bootcamp 为 Ubuntu 创建第二个分区或者使用 Refit(或该开放式启动管理器的任何名称)?

答案1

rEFIt 自 2010 年初以来就没有更新过。我的分支,rEFInd,正在积极开发中,并包含帮助启动 Linux 的功能,因此在大多数情况下它是比 rEFIt 更好的选择。

除非你使用 Windows 或其他仅 BIOS 操作系统进行三重启动,否则我建议至少尝试让 Linux 的原生 EFI 模式启动正常工作。这意味着你应该不是使用 Boot Camp 或创建混合型MBR——事实上,我提供此建议的主要原因是因为混合 MBR 非常危险,如链接页面所述。话虽如此,一些使用某些型号的用户报告说,某些硬件(通常是视频硬件)在 EFI 模式下启动时工作不良或根本不工作,因此可能需要 BIOS 模式启动 Linux。不过,我建议您将此视为后备方案。

我写了一个关于在 EFI 模式下在 Mac 上安装 Ubuntu 的网页;请参阅这里。不幸的是,该页面有点过时了,而且我唯一的 Mac 是相当老的 32 位型号,因此对于较新的 64 位 Mac 用户来说,某些细节可能会有所不同。不过,它可能是一个有用的参考。

答案2

请看这里:https://wiki.ubuntu.com/MactelSupportTeam/CommunityHelpPages

我通常推荐 Refit,但首先请检查一下链接。

答案3

我将 Mac 设置为双启动,以便 Ubuntu 首先启动;您必须按住选项才能进入 Mac EFI。我相信这有一个名称,但我不太清楚这些术语。

基本步骤是

  • 创建 Mac Live USB
  • 重新格式化硬盘
  • 对驱动器进行分区,确保安装 Mac OS 的驱动器已针对 Mac 进行格式化,Linux 驱动器已针对 Linux 进行格式化
  • 安装 Linux
  • 安装 Mac

我这样做是因为我发现所有地方的共识是 Boot Camp 都是垃圾。这在我的机器上对两种操作系统都很好用,尽管 Mac 的恢复功能消失了,所以你一定要有一个恢复 USB。

相关内容